Phillip Sheath has authored 6 papers that have received a total of 850 indexed citations.
This includes 4 papers in Materials Chemistry, 3 papers in Biomedical Engineering and 2 papers in Electrical and Electronic Engineering. The topics of these papers are Graphene research and applications (3 papers), Electrohydrodynamics and Fluid Dynamics (1 paper) and Visual perception and processing mechanisms (1 paper). Phillip Sheath is often cited by papers focused on Graphene research and applications (3 papers), Electrohydrodynamics and Fluid Dynamics (1 paper) and Visual perception and processing mechanisms (1 paper) and collaborates with scholars based in Australia, United States and Spain. Phillip Sheath's co-authors include Mainak Majumder, Mahdokht Shaibani, Rachel Tkacz, Abozar Akbari and Parama Chakraborty Banerjee and has published in prestigious journals such as Nature Communications, ACS Nano and Chemistry of Materials.
